INSTALL-INFO(1) User Commands INSTALL-INFO(1)

NAME

install-info - update info/dir entries

SYNOPSIS

iinnssttaallll-iinnffoo [OPTION]... [INFO-FILE [DIR-FILE]]

DESCRIPTION

Install or delete dir entries from INFO-FILE in the Info directory file

DIR-FILE.

OOPPTTIIOONNSS

--ddeelleettee

delete existing entries for INFO-FILE from DIR-FILE; don't

insert any new entries.

--ddiirr-ffiillee=NAME

specify file name of Info directory file. This is equivalent to

using the DIR-FILE argument.

--eennttrryy=TEXT

insert TEXT as an Info directory entry. TEXT should have the form of an Info menu item line plus zero or more extra lines starting with whitespace. If you specify more than one entry, they are all added. If you don't specify any entries, they are determined from information in the Info file itself.

--hheellpp display this help and exit.

--iinnffoo-ffiillee=FILE

specify Info file to install in the directory. This is equiva-

lent to using the INFO-FILE argument.

--iinnffoo-ddiirr=DIR

same as --ddiirr-ffiillee=DIR/dir.

--iitteemm=TEXT

same as --eennttrryy TEXT. An Info directory entry is actually a

menu item.

--qquuiieett

suppress warnings.

--rreemmoovvee

same as --ddeelleettee.

--sseeccttiioonn=SEC

put this file's entries in section SEC of the directory. If you specify more than one section, all the entries are added in each of the sections. If you don't specify any sections, they are determined from information in the Info file itself.

--vveerrssiioonn

display version information and exit.
